  • Opened at noon and just poured two small glasses, the nose was showing some ripe red currants, it tasted quite light with ripe red cherries and a hint of drying tannins, the wine didn't develop much with 15 min in the glass... I thought it was already a performance for a 57 years old Chateauneuf to be drinkable... 88 points
    In the evening, after 10 hours slow oxygenation, I was not expecting much... but it started quite well with a beautifull nose of very ripe red raspberries and strawberries, brown sugar, asian spices, very animal nose... also the taste was beautifull, with sweet raspberries, asian spices and a nice acidity... the wine became better with every glass, and at the end we were fighting for the last sip of this bottle... great wine 94 points!!
